Growth oil is suitable for all hair types, including natural, relaxed, locs, curly, wavy and straight hair. It can be used by men, women & children (consult a professional for age recommendations). Always check the ingredients if you have allergies or sensitivities.
Yes, many growth oils contain ingredients like Tea Tree oil, Peppermint or Lavender, which have soothing as well as antimicrobial properties that can help reduce dandruff & itching.
Yes, growth oil can be used on eyebrows & beards to promote thickness and growth. Apply a small amount and massage gently. Avoid getting any product in the eyes.
Yes, you can mix growth oil with other hair care products like conditioners, masks, or leave-in treatments to enhance their benefits.
Yes, if applied excessively or if the oil contains comedogenic ingredients (those that clog pores), it can cause breakouts along the scalp or hairline. Use a lightweight, non-comedogenic formula if you have acne-prone skin and avoid over-application.
Growth oil can help nourish the scalp & encourage regrowth, but postpartum hair loss is often due to hormonal changes. Combining oil use with a healthy diet and medical advice can provide better results.
Growth oils can help improve circulation and nourish the scalp, which may support regrowth in early stages of traction alopecia. Full restoration depends on the amount of active follicles. Consistency & proper scalp care are essential to getting the best results possible.
Growth oil is most effective on a slightly damp scalp because the moisture helps the oil spread evenly and absorb better. Applying oil to dry hair is also fine, but it may require more product.
Yes, but choose growth oils with soothing ingredients like Chamomile or Aloe Vera and avoid harsh essential oils like Peppermint or Tea Tree, which may irritate sensitive skin.
Yes, growth oils can be especially beneficial for color-treated or processed hair by replenishing lost moisture and strengthening weakened strands. Look for sulfate-free & color-safe formulations.
